Ethel Almira McGuire was born in 1900 in Michigan, USA, the child of Arthur George Maguire And Clara Frantz. In 1930, Ethel Almira McGuire resided in Portland (Districts 271-553), Portland, Multnomah,. In 1935, Ethel Almira McGuire resided in Portland, Multnomah, Oregon. Ethel Almira McGuire married Carl Percy Johnson, and had children including Clara Mae Johnson, Kenneth A Johnson, Sharon Johnson. Ethel Almira McGuire passed away in 1963 in Portland, Multnomah County, Oregon, United States of America.
